    VIN Number

    The VIN is unique to your car and acts as an identification number. It has 17 characters, which include capital letters and digits. Every vehicle has a unique VIN and therefore, there are no two vehicles with the same code. This number is used to track recalls registrations and warranties, insurance coverage, and thefts. The VIN can also be used to determine the vehicle's model year and trim level, as well as the make. The VIN is found on many documents associated to the vehicle, including the registration and title paperwork.

    The first three digits are called the World Manufacturer Identifier (WMI). This tells you where the car was manufactured and by whom. The next digits indicate the car's type and then the vehicle model and then the trim and engine type. The ninth character is used to confirm the authenticity of the VIN.

    VINs were first used in 1954, however for a number of years there was no standard format. In 1981, the National Highway Traffic Safety Administration mandated that every vehicle have an official VIN. VINs are now 17 digits in length and have three sections. The first section is a reference to the country of origin, the next is the manufacturer's name and the third one identifies the type of vehicle.

    Each section is assigned a distinct meaning. For example, the fourth digit indicates whether the vehicle is a cargo or passenger vehicle. The fifth digit is the serial number while the seventh digit is the vehicle engine code, and the last four digits are the body style and the trim level.

    Broken Key

    It is always a shock when your car keys break inside the lock. You might be able to wiggle out the broken piece or you may have to resort more drastic measures.

    Many people use tweezers in attempt to get rid of a damaged lock key. But, this could be a very dangerous approach. Many tweezers are too small and could end up pushing the broken key deeper into the lock. Instead, it is a better idea to use pliers that grip the edge of the key and remove it.

    Make use of lubricant to pull a broken lock key out. It will make it much easier to remove the key as well as open the door. Many local auto shops offer Lubricant.

    You could also try using wire or a paperclip to grab the edge of the broken key and leverage it out. This method tends to work best with a little bit of lubricant. It is also more effective when the key is not very deep in the lock.

    Key extractors are another option. This is an effective way to extract the damaged part of a key from a lock. However, you will need to have access to a locksmith professional or borrow one.

    Finally, you can always contact roadside assistance and request them to take your vehicle to the dealership to get an alternative key. You may be stuck without a vehicle for a couple of weeks if they don't have the right key.
